Industrial & Environmental Hygiene (IEH) provides all-encompassing management and administration of environmental hygiene inclusive of: asbestos, lead, PCBs, indoor air quality, mold, hazardous materials, underground storage tanks, environmental due diligence for site development acquisitions, potable water, chemical relocation, soil excavation/characterization and disposal. IEH works very closely with Architecture & Engineering (A&E) and Construction Management (CM).

Industrial Hygienist B - (Field Operations)

Responsibilities include:
  • Conducts initial review of all construction documents to ensure compliance with appropriate provisions related to environmental conditions before they are sent for final approval.
  • Coordinates all phases of environmental projects assigned.
  • Coordinates all administrative project aspects relevant to Environmental conditions for all projects assigned.
  • Monitors job sites to determine the presence of occupational health hazards and ensures that industrial hygiene standards are maintained and appropriate safety provisions are observed.
  • Prepares special reports requested by supervisors.
  • Recommends appropriate equipment and techniques for protection against exposure to harmful substances and hazardous conditions or operations.
  • Educates/trains project stakeholders regarding matters of industrial hygiene.
  • Performs related tasks.
May Perform The Duties Of Industrial Hygienist - A
  • Collects samples of potentially hazardous materials for analysis.
  • Coordinates asbestos abatement activities on construction projects.
  • Assists in review of construction documents to assure appropriate provisions relating to industrial hygiene with emphasis on the handling of asbestos.
  • Prepares reports recommending both preventative and corrective action with respect to industrial hygiene, as well as providing technical guidance, as required.
  • Performs related tasks.

Minimum Requirements For Industrial Hygienist - B (Field Operations)
  • Three years of full time experience performing hazard/toxic substance assessments, or a satisfactory combination of education and experience.
  • Must have a minimum of three years of experience specializing in field operations.
  • City Certified Investigator or State Department of Labor Project Monitor Certification Required.
Minimum Requirements For Industrial Hygienist - C (QA/QC)
  • Four years of full time experience performing hazard/toxic substance assessments, OR a satisfactory combination of education and experience.
  • Must have a minimum of four years of experience specializing in Quality Assurance/Quality Control field operations.
